Vegetation in equatorial climates has adapted through several key features to thrive in the warm, humid environment with consistent rainfall. Many plants have broad leaves to maximize photosynthesis and capture sunlight in the dense canopy. Additionally, they often exhibit rapid growth rates, allowing them to compete for light, and some species have developed shallow root systems to quickly absorb surface moisture. Furthermore, adaptations such as drip tips on leaves help to shed excess water, preventing fungal growth and optimizing nutrient uptake.
Countries directly on the equator typically experience a hot and humid climate with consistent temperatures throughout the year. This climate is known as an equatorial or tropical rainforest climate, characterized by high rainfall and dense vegetation. It is common in countries such as Brazil, Indonesia, and the Democratic Republic of the Congo.
No, Africa's distribution of climate and vegetation is not symmetrical about the equator. The continent's climate and vegetation vary greatly from north to south and are influenced by factors such as altitude, proximity to oceans, and prevailing wind patterns. This leads to diverse ecosystems ranging from deserts in the north to tropical rainforests in the equatorial regions.

Locations near the equator. An equatorial climate is a type of tropical climate in which there is no dry season and all months have mean precipitation values of at least 60mm. It is usually found at latitudes within five degrees of the equator and tropical rainforest is the natural vegetation. ------------ This was taken from wikipedia ------------

Humid equatorial refers to a climate zone characterized by high temperatures and high humidity throughout the year, typically found near the equator. This climate features abundant rainfall, often exceeding 2000 mm annually, and is marked by a lack of distinct seasons, with consistent warm temperatures and lush vegetation. The humid equatorial climate supports diverse ecosystems, including tropical rainforests, which are rich in biodiversity.
The natural vegetation of a hot wet equatorial climate typically includes dense tropical rainforests with a wide variety of plant species such as tall trees, epiphytes, lianas, and ferns. These rainforests are characterized by high biodiversity and constant warmth and moisture, supporting a complex ecosystem of plants and animals. This type of vegetation is often found near the equator, where temperatures are consistently high and there is abundant rainfall throughout the year.
